Dear Christine,
The class act of the American museum system suppliers is Delta Designs Ltd.,
P.O. Box 1783, Topeka, Kansas 66601 (913-284-2244 fax 913-233-1021). Note
the contact info is several years old. They designed and built an amazing
cabinet installation for us for the storage of our silver and small metal
sculpture collections.

>We are looking for makers of museum quality artifact storage cabinets. I
>have materials from one such vendor, Steel Manufacturing Company in Kansas
>City. We are not able to accomodate compact storage shelves so we're
>looking for individual units to store a combination of surgical
>instruments, doctor's bags, uniforms, microscopes, and other medical
>equipment. Thank you in advance for any tips and suggestions.
